DeluxeBB pm.php cross-site scripting

deluxebb-pm-xss (27359) The risk level is classified as MediumMedium Risk

Description:

DeluxeBB is vulnerable to cross-site scripting, caused by improper validation of user-supplied input by the pm.php script. A remote attacker could exploit this vulnerability using the 'subject' or 'to' parameter to execute script in a victim's Web browser within the security context of the hosting Web site, allowing the attacker to steal the victim's cookie-based authentication credentials.


Consequences:

Gain Access

Remedy:

Upgrade to the latest updated version of DeluxeBB (1.07 or later), available from the DeluxeBB Web site. See References.
